The Granollers Manifesto on Cultivated Biodiversity and Local Food Policies Presented at the Milan Urban Food Policy Pact Global Forum

Oct 28, 2025

Milan, October 16, 2025. During the Global Forum of the Milan Urban Food Policy Pact (MUFPP), held from 13 to 16 October in Milan under the theme “Building on a decade of joint success. Envisioning the future of urban food systems”, the Spanish Network of Agroecological Municipalities (Red de Municipios por la Agroecología-RMAe) and the European project LiveSeeding co-organised the session “Local Food System Transformation through Agroecology – Tools and Successful Cases from South America, Africa and Europe”, together with several international partners.

Granollers Manifesto on “Fostering Cultivated Biodiversity in European Municipalities”

In this session, María Carrascosa, from RMAe, presented the Granollers Manifesto: “Fostering Cultivated Biodiversity in European Municipalities”, the key outcome of the 1st European Symposium on Cultivated Biodiversity and Local Food Policies, held in Granollers (Spain) in April 2025.

The Manifesto proposes 32 practical actions to integrate into city-region food systems, especially local and traditional varieties, materials as a result of organic or participatory plant breeding, locally adapted cultivars, and open-source seed populations. It also includes policy, regulatory and financial recommendations aimed at regional, national and EU institutions to strengthen municipal action in this area.

During the session, Gilles Pérole, Deputy Mayor of Mouans-Sartoux (France), shared several initiatives implemented by the municipality to embed cultivated biodiversity into local public policies.
